Harbor Spring Capital's Q3 2023 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2023, Harbor Spring Capital held 22 positions worth $19.3M, down 89% from $178M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 100% of the portfolio.
Harbor Spring Capital withdrew a net $163M in Q3 2023, closing 20 positions and reducing 2 holdings. Its most notable exit was SS&C Technologies, an estimated $17.5M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 71% of assets, up from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.
